Transaction 3d09c22d253a6f9f05937533dd7f451305f40e7c36d3a14dfe17c798a6947cd9
1 Input
2 Outputs
- 3d09c22d253a6f9f05937533dd7f451305f40e7c36d3a14dfe17c798a6947cd9:0
- 3d09c22d253a6f9f05937533dd7f451305f40e7c36d3a14dfe17c798a6947cd9:1
value 8139028860
address mmzXSDshiR5PwD4sN7zAA3Tx6NGpd1nd8j
value 20100000
address mgEki7sHbZP41nBWWXz2EJ6VejmFegKDzi